Early Life: Roots and Beginnings
When you hear the name Brendan Coyle, you might immediately think of his iconic role as John Bates in the beloved series "Downton Abbey." But there’s so much more to this talented actor than meets the eye. Born on December 2, 1963, in Corby, Northamptonshire, England, Brendan’s story begins in a small town with big dreams. His parents, hailing from County Tyrone, Ireland, and Scotland respectively, moved to Corby in search of a better life. Little did they know that their son would grow up to become one of Britain’s most respected actors.
A Family Legacy
Brendan Coyle wasn’t just born into an ordinary family; his father, a master butcher, ran a bustling shop in Rugby, Warwickshire. It was here that Brendan spent his early years, learning the family trade while dreaming of a different path. His parents emigrated from Strabane, County Tyrone, Ireland, bringing with them a rich cultural heritage that undoubtedly shaped young Brendan’s worldview. Despite his humble beginnings, Coyle always had a passion for storytelling, which eventually led him to the world of acting.

The Downton Abbey Phenomenon
When "Downton Abbey" premiered in 2010, it quickly became a global phenomenon. Fans were captivated by the grandeur of the estate, the intricate relationships, and the unforgettable characters. Among them was John Bates, the loyal yet troubled manservant played by Brendan Coyle. Coyle brought depth and authenticity to the role, earning him both critical acclaim and a devoted fanbase. His performance was so compelling that fans demanded more even after the show concluded in 2015. This led to the creation of a highly anticipated sequel, continuing the legacy of the series.
A Versatile Career: Beyond Downton Abbey
Brendan Coyle’s career extends far beyond his time in Downton Abbey. With over 70 movies and TV series under his belt, Coyle has proven himself as a master of his craft. From his early days in theater, where he won a Laurence Olivier Award for his performance in "The Weir," to his starring roles in films like "Mary Queen of Scots" and "Requiem," Coyle has consistently delivered memorable performances. His versatility is unmatched, whether he’s portraying a historical figure, a detective, or a supernatural entity.
Exploring New Horizons
In recent years, Brendan Coyle has expanded his repertoire by taking on new challenges. He’s ventured into producing, working on projects that align with his passions and values. Additionally, he’s been involved in philanthropic efforts, using his platform to give back to the community. Fans can look forward to seeing him in upcoming projects, including the Netflix miniseries "Toxic Town," which premieres in 2025. Written by Jack Thorne, this gripping drama is based on the true story of a landmark case involving toxic waste in Corby, adding a personal touch to Coyle’s involvement.
